This print captures the essence of elegance and sophistication at the Indian Empire Garden Party held at Hurlingham on 1st July 1935. The focal point of the image is Mrs. Grosvenor-Collins, wife of Major Grosvenor-Collins from Welwyn, Hertfordshire. Dressed in a stunning fancy dress costume, she exudes grace and charm. The fashion of the era is beautifully showcased in this monochrome photograph. Mrs. Grosvenor-Collins dons an exquisite parasol that adds a touch of glamour to her ensemble, while her elaborate hat completes her stylish look. Her husband stands beside her, equally dapper in his attire. Taken by renowned photographer Alfieri, this snapshot transports us back to the glamorous world of 1930s Europeana photography. The picture encapsulates not only a moment frozen in time but also reflects the social customs and trends prevalent during that era. As we gaze upon this remarkable image, we are reminded of an age when garden parties were grand affairs filled with opulence and refinement. This print serves as a visual testament to the enduring allure of vintage fashion and offers us a glimpse into a bygone era where style reigned supreme
